3 alternatives to GitHub Copilot to keep an eye out for
Tabnine (once known as Codota) was one of the first code completion tools to hit the market. In your favorite IDEs, the Tabnine code completion plugin supports all of the most popular languages, libraries, and frameworks. Tabnine AI models are only trained on permissive open-source licensed code, ensuring your code remains yours.

Tabnine vs Kite 2021: best AI-Powered Auto-Completion tool?
Kite saves the memory f your computer which means it uses very little memory. If we compare the memory usage analysis of both Kite and TabNine we will come to know that TabNine requires almost 4Gb memory for a project of 10-line code. Whereas kite uses only 550 Mb memory for the same project. It implies that Kite uses almost 85% less memory.
